Early inspection is strongly recommended to appreciate many original style features including tiled flooring, cornicing, picture rails and fireplaces. Comprising of two reception rooms, fitted kitchen with integral appliances, ground floor shower room to the ground floor with two bedrooms, one with an ensuite to the first floor. Complete with gas central heating system, uPVC double glazing, this property is suited to a range of buyers including the first-time purchaser, rental investor or those looking to downsize. Accessed through a PVC door with glazed inserts into:

Entrance vestibule Tiled flooring door to:

Hall Tiled flooring, dado rail and stairs to first floor. Doors to lounge and dining room.

Lounge 13' 10" x 9' 3" (4.22m x 2.82m) widest point Feature brick fire place with wooden mantle, coving to ceiling, dado rail and radiator. UPVC double glazed window to front.

Dining room 12' 9" x 10' 2" (3.89m x 3.1m) Central feature coal effect living flame gas fire with Adam's style surround, radiator and uPVC double glazed window to rear. Door to:

Kitchen 16' 3" x 6' 3" (4.95m x 1.91m) Fitted with a range of base, wall and drawer units with wooden worktop over incorporating sink and drainer with mixer tap, chrome handles and contrasting splash back tiling. Integrated electric double oven and electric hob with cooker hood over. Space and plumbing for washing machine, uPVC double glazed window to side, external door to rear yard and door to:

Shower room 6' 3" x 5' 11" (1.91m x 1.81m) Three piece suite comprising of WC, wash hand vanity basin and shower cubicle. Two uPVC double glazed windows to side and tiling.

First floor landing Door to two bedrooms.

Bedroom 12' 9" x 12' 3" (3.89m x 3.73m) Double room with storage cupboard offer access to loft, radiator and uPVC double glazed window to front.

Bedroom 10' 2" x 12' 9" (3.1m x 3.89m) Further double room with uPVC double glazed window to rear, storage cupboard housing combination boiler for the hot water and heating system and radiator. Door to:

Ensuite Modern three piece suite in white comprising of WC, wash hand basin and bath. Tiling to walls and uPVC double glazed window to side.

Exterior Gated forecourt with access to front entrance door. Yard to the rear with access to the rear service lane.

General information tenure: Freehold

council tax: A

local authority: Westmorland & Furness Council

services: Mains drainage, gas, electric, water are all connected
